Fully Digital X-ray System DigitalDiagnost C90

Digital Diagnost C90

The Philips DigitalDiagnost C90 is designed for the acquisition, processing, storage, display, and export of digital radiographic images. The DigitalDiagnost C90 is suitable for all routine radiographic examinations, including specialties such as intensive care, traumatology and paediatrics, except fluoroscopy, angiography and mammography.

Standard radiography procedures include:

• X-ray examinations of the skeleton, including the skull, chest, spine, pelvis, upper limbs, lower limbs, etc.;
• X-ray examinations of the lungs;
• X-ray examinations of soft tissue, e.g., the abdomen;
• full spine imaging in the patient’s vertical and horizontal positions;
• full leg imaging in the patient’s vertical and horizontal positions.

The following acquisition techniques are available to the user:
• detector acquisition with vertical, horizontal, and/or oblique X-ray beam;
• flexible acquisition technique for the flexible SkyPlate detector;
• flexible acquisition technique for Philips or other suppliers’ CR systems and film cassettes;
• manual acquisition techniques: kV-mA-ms; kV-mAs; kV-mAs-ms;
• automatic acquisition technique: AEC kV, mA, AEC-kV with falling load.
